WebApr 1, 2000 · The idea behind a dry chemical fire extinguisher is to blanket the fuel with an inert solid (similar to dirt or sand). A dry chemical extinguisher sprays a very fine powder of sodium bicarbonate (NaHCO3, baking soda), potassium bicarbonate (KHCO3, nearly identical to baking soda), or monoammonium phosphate ( (NH4)H2PO4).

Free shipping for … WebThe ABC fire extinguisher is considered the “universal” fire extinguisher because it can combat A, B and C type fires. ABC fire extinguishers contains dry chemical, usually a mixture of monoammonium phosphate and ammonium sulfate. This is the most common fire extinguisher found across the UMass Boston campus.
